)]}'
{"/PATCHSET_LEVEL":[{"author":{"_account_id":35263,"name":"Matt Crees","email":"mattc@stackhpc.com","username":"mattcrees"},"change_message_id":"2a2336b6cb7687f067f84f7a13c11369056bcd0b","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":8,"id":"d937ee9f_e8a5109b","updated":"2024-08-29 10:48:48.000000000","message":"LGTM","commit_id":"2950909d9b871ffb7ac98039d2c6743be620383f"},{"author":{"_account_id":15197,"name":"Pierre Riteau","email":"pierre@stackhpc.com","username":"priteau","status":"StackHPC"},"change_message_id":"d55b9cb5b0aa3fc357d8f8c82348e326d2bab275","unresolved":false,"context_lines":[],"source_content_type":"","patch_set":8,"id":"d3dcc665_b4d7cb2a","updated":"2024-09-03 19:24:18.000000000","message":"Thanks for the reviews.","commit_id":"2950909d9b871ffb7ac98039d2c6743be620383f"}],"blazar_tempest_plugin/config.py":[{"author":{"_account_id":35263,"name":"Matt Crees","email":"mattc@stackhpc.com","username":"mattcrees"},"change_message_id":"db465acb86b070c902c9ec217dd930676949b2d4","unresolved":true,"context_lines":[{"line_number":42,"context_line":"    cfg.IntOpt(\u0027lease_end_timeout\u0027,"},{"line_number":43,"context_line":"               default\u003d300,"},{"line_number":44,"context_line":"               help\u003d\"Timeout in seconds to wait for a lease to finish.\"),"},{"line_number":45,"context_line":"    cfg.BootOpt(\u0027flavor_instance_plugin\u0027,"},{"line_number":46,"context_line":"                default\u003dTrue,"},{"line_number":47,"context_line":"                help\u003d\"Whether to test flavor-based instance reservation\")"},{"line_number":48,"context_line":"]"}],"source_content_type":"text/x-python","patch_set":7,"id":"36dc4566_fe00188f","line":45,"updated":"2024-08-29 09:46:40.000000000","message":"Did you mean to change this ``BoolOpt`` -\u003e ``BootOpt``?","commit_id":"da5b00b08975de49dfcc178a50d857a8e13953fc"},{"author":{"_account_id":15197,"name":"Pierre Riteau","email":"pierre@stackhpc.com","username":"priteau","status":"StackHPC"},"change_message_id":"16bab056c30372ced94ea00e74792798cc5cebdf","unresolved":false,"context_lines":[{"line_number":42,"context_line":"    cfg.IntOpt(\u0027lease_end_timeout\u0027,"},{"line_number":43,"context_line":"               default\u003d300,"},{"line_number":44,"context_line":"               help\u003d\"Timeout in seconds to wait for a lease to finish.\"),"},{"line_number":45,"context_line":"    cfg.BootOpt(\u0027flavor_instance_plugin\u0027,"},{"line_number":46,"context_line":"                default\u003dTrue,"},{"line_number":47,"context_line":"                help\u003d\"Whether to test flavor-based instance reservation\")"},{"line_number":48,"context_line":"]"}],"source_content_type":"text/x-python","patch_set":7,"id":"ca96acf3_963d42aa","line":45,"in_reply_to":"36dc4566_fe00188f","updated":"2024-08-29 09:51:23.000000000","message":"I accidentally reverted my fix from yesterday.","commit_id":"da5b00b08975de49dfcc178a50d857a8e13953fc"}],"blazar_tempest_plugin/tests/scenario/test_flavor_reservation.py":[{"author":{"_account_id":35263,"name":"Matt Crees","email":"mattc@stackhpc.com","username":"mattcrees"},"change_message_id":"698c88315434b2427d46a4bbabef735225ab21ce","unresolved":true,"context_lines":[{"line_number":38,"context_line":""},{"line_number":39,"context_line":"    def setUp(self):"},{"line_number":40,"context_line":"        super(TestFlavorReservationScenario, self).setUp()"},{"line_number":41,"context_line":"        # Setup image and flavor the test instance"},{"line_number":42,"context_line":"        # Support both configured and injected values"},{"line_number":43,"context_line":"        if not hasattr(self, \u0027image_ref\u0027):"},{"line_number":44,"context_line":"            self.image_ref \u003d CONF.compute.image_ref"}],"source_content_type":"text/x-python","patch_set":6,"id":"7c3c88d7_3f85d93c","line":41,"updated":"2024-08-29 08:55:46.000000000","message":"```suggestion\n        # Setup image and flavor for the test instance\n```","commit_id":"c8c1b80746ebb43d8beef03c6e9831cb88bf74db"},{"author":{"_account_id":15197,"name":"Pierre Riteau","email":"pierre@stackhpc.com","username":"priteau","status":"StackHPC"},"change_message_id":"102e82661818d57bf32caada0ecbec8d87999550","unresolved":false,"context_lines":[{"line_number":38,"context_line":""},{"line_number":39,"context_line":"    def setUp(self):"},{"line_number":40,"context_line":"        super(TestFlavorReservationScenario, self).setUp()"},{"line_number":41,"context_line":"        # Setup image and flavor the test instance"},{"line_number":42,"context_line":"        # Support both configured and injected values"},{"line_number":43,"context_line":"        if not hasattr(self, \u0027image_ref\u0027):"},{"line_number":44,"context_line":"            self.image_ref \u003d CONF.compute.image_ref"}],"source_content_type":"text/x-python","patch_set":6,"id":"74405caf_decfbc9e","line":41,"in_reply_to":"7c3c88d7_3f85d93c","updated":"2024-08-29 09:40:52.000000000","message":"Done","commit_id":"c8c1b80746ebb43d8beef03c6e9831cb88bf74db"}]}
